打赏

相关文章

最短路径问题-------Dijkstra算法

定义: Dijkstra(迪杰斯特拉)算法是计算单源最短路径算法,用于计算一个结点到其他所有结点的最短路径。该算法以源点为起始点,不断更新其他点到已经确定距离结点的距离,选取距离最小的结点加入S集合,直到S集合存放有所…

数据结构与算法(test2)

五、串 1. 串是由___零___个或___多____个字符组成的有限序列, 又称为___字符串________。 一般记为 S“a1a2.....an” (n > 0), 串中的字符数目n称为串的__长度_____,零个字符的串称为___空串_____. 定义中谈到的"有限"是指长度 n 是一个有限的数值…

动态规划part3|背包问题、 416. 分割等和子集

01背包问题 二维 🔗:代码随想录46. 携带研究材料(第六期模拟笔试)代码随想录思路: 第一次接触背包问题,代码随想录介绍的比较详细,需要注意怎么更新dp的数字代码随想录 代码: impor…

如何在 Python 中开启多线程调试

1. 编写多线程代码 首先,我们需要有一个多线程的 Python 程序作为示例。以下是一个简单的多线程示例代码: import threading import timedef worker(num):"""线程要执行的任务"""print(f"线程 {num} 开始执行"…

C++设计模式 —— 单例模式

设计模式 —— 单例模式 一个问题C11后代写法单例模式的两种模式饿汉模式懒汉模式 在了解C面向对象的三大特性:封装,继承,多态之后。我们创建类的时候就有了比较大的空间。但是,我们平时在创建类的时候,不是简单写个cl…

手机版浏览

扫一扫体验

微信公众账号

微信扫一扫加关注

返回
顶部